Transaction 2e592b4e44f1bd589b22d1fa13eae0f71e269162b9800e286d170097c95d16ee

1 Input
2 Outputs
  • 2e592b4e44f1bd589b22d1fa13eae0f71e269162b9800e286d170097c95d16ee:0
  • value  580215
    address  3HSCnoJ1c3cbWYgAAXD2jdufvRjRSVAodk
  • 2e592b4e44f1bd589b22d1fa13eae0f71e269162b9800e286d170097c95d16ee:1
  • value  7214764
    address  3FX6xY81iDtMx7HDTbQVsWWNp3Vz6Yz9Ny